Knock out criteria: Paper is NOT assessed unless these criteria are met.
1. Correct in text references Yes No
2. Annotated bibliography Yes No
3. Ephorus check Yes No

4. Body: Results 10 points
Are all relevant hard facts included to provide the reader with a clear picture of the issue?
Are there sufficient primary data to support the argument (statistics, maps, time lines,
official documents etc.)?
Are there sufficient secondary data to support the argument?
Is the relevant literature presented logically?
Does the literature also include domestic sources when applicable?
5. Body: Analysis 10 points
Is there a convincing, logical interpretation of the results?
Are the in-text references in the required APA formatting (last name, year, page number)?
Are all in-text references in the same format?
Are page/paragraph numbers always included after a direct quote?
Are signal phrases appropriately used to introduce quotes and paraphrases?
Are in-text references properly used throughout the text when required and not only at the
end of a paragraph?
Are no more than two successive paragraphs drawn from a single source?
Formatting and Style 5 points
Does the paper include the required running head?
Does the heading include the short title and the page numbers?
Is the table of content included?
Is the font style clear and readable (size 11 or 12)?
Is the text justified throughout?
Is there 1 ½ spacing between lines and normal margins?
Are the sections following one another without blank spaces (each section not on a new pg)?
Does the title page include all required info (full title, name of student, ID number)?
Does the paper fall within the 6 to 8 page range?
Is the level of English adequate so as not to hinder the communication of ideas and
arguments?
